Peter James
Peter James is a UK No.1 bestselling author, best known for his Detective Superintendent Roy Grace series, now a hit ITV drama starring John Simm as the troubled Brighton copper. Much loved by crime and thriller fans for his fast-paced page-turners full of unexpected plot twists, sinister characters, and accurate portrayal of modern day policing, he has won over 40 awards for his work including the WHSmith Best Crime Author of All Time Award and Crime Writers’ Association Diamond Dagger. To date, Peter has written an impressive total of 19 Sunday Times No. 1s, sold over 21 million copies worldwide and been translated into 38 languages. His books are also often adapted for the stage – the most recent being Looking Good Dead.

- Rating: 4 out of 5 stars4/5A bit disappointing, the plot seems a it strung out and I'd guessed the villian and his probable location well before it was revealed. The villian's lair seemed highly improbable and that it could have existed without drawing attention of some sort, especially as it was highly unlikely it could have been constructed without help. The continuing sub-plot of Grace's missing wife is getting a bit tedious without a resolution. On the plus side, the police procedural elements, as always appear very authentic and detailed, as they should be given the author's sources!

- Rating: 5 out of 5 stars5/5Yet another excellent outing with Roy Grace and his team. These are always excellent reads, with good plotting and always leave you feeling part of the investigation. However, following the incidents in the last book (no spoilers) this did feel slightly different in some ways. I always enjoy the morning and evening briefing sessions, but there seemed to be less of these in this book and I did miss them. Some new members of the team were introduced in this book and hopefully they will grow on me as the series progresses. It is definitely good to see Glenn Branson's life progress. I would definitely recommend this series to anyone who enjoys a good detective book and enjoys feeling part of the investigation process. All I need to do now is wait for the next one to be written.
- Rating: 4 out of 5 stars4/5I think all the series I read, released new books in a short spate of time leading me to realize just how many I follow.So, this is another I have followed from the beginning. Roy Grace has finally found some peace and happiness after the mysterious disappearance of his wife, Sandy, many years ago. When a young girl is reported missing he finds himself embroiled in a case that may lead back thirty years or so. He knows he is following a diabolical kilter but why he finds is so much worse than he expected.Solid police procedural, not horribly graphic so definitely not a slasher type of story. Cat and mouse chase, Grace pitting himself and his resources against a killer who thinks he is clever enough to fool the police and remain free. But is he? ARC from Netgalley.
